If only people would make their links a clicky using the site name, then a search using the site name would work as this would be text within the post. In the "old days" most comps were posted this way.
e.g I always post LOVE READING as a clicky for their comps so when I search using "love reading" and restrict the search to 1 or 2 months from "today" then the results returned are mostly the ones I need to see. Not the absolute best example as I also get LOVE READING 4 KIDS as well but I can live with that. A search on "Love Reading 4 Kids" works very nicely.
The Good Housekeeping comps are posted with just the url, like this one, https://forums.moneysavingexpert.com/discussion/6270059/e-21-06-md-win-a-nutribullet-blender-combo-this-summer, which makes the site virtually unsearchable. In the case of this specific comp, you could search for "nutribullet blender" as that is the prize mentioned in the Title but you are relying on the poster putting those exact words in the post/title and hope that there are not too many comps for that specific prize. (In fact, using "nutribullet blender" with 2 months in the date within parameter box, that thread is the only result.) The quote marks are essential when searching for 2 or more words. Without the quotes search returns any posts containing either of the words rather than both. This is a bit long winded if you need to search for several comps on the same site as each has to be done separately.1 -
